7-nitrotetrahydroisoquinoline (35.6 mg, 0.2 mmol), graphene oxide (8 mg),And a stirrer is placed in the reaction tube, after replacing the inert gas,Add 1 ml of DMF and seal the reaction tube. Place the reaction tube in a 150C oil bath reaction potThe reaction was stirred for 18 hours; after cooling to room temperature, the catalyst was removed by filtration.The filtrate was diluted with 15 mL of water, diluted with 15 mL of water and extracted 3 times with ethyl acetate, 15 mL each time; the extracts were combined and dried over anhydrous sodium sulfate and filtered.The filtrate was concentrated under reduced pressure, and the crude product was subjected to column chromatography with ethyl acetate:petroleum ether=1:3 (containing 1% triethylamine) as eluent to obtain a pure product.Brown oil, yield 46%.
